Tom Tromey 1d14dd5887 Minor changes to Ada tests for gnat-llvm
I found a few more spots where a minor modification to a test lets it
pass with gnat-llvm:

* For array_subcript_addr, gnat-llvm was not putting the array into
  memory.  Making the array larger works around this.

* For bp_inlined_func, it is normal for gnat-llvm to sometimes emit a
  call to an out-of-line copy of the function, so accept this.

* For null_overload and type-tick-size, I've applied the usual fix for
  keeping an unused local variable alive.

with pck; use pck;
procedure Foo is
type R_Type is null record;
type R_Access is access R_Type;
type U_0 is mod 1;
type U_P_T is access all U_0;
function F (R : R_Access) return Boolean is
begin
return True;
end F;
function F (I : Integer) return Boolean is
begin
return False;
end F;
B1 : constant Boolean := F (null);
B2 : constant Boolean := F (0);
U : U_0 := 0;
U_Ptr : U_P_T := null;
begin
Do_Nothing (U_Ptr'Address); -- START
end Foo;
